SUMMARY


Under immediate supervision, responsible for performing a variety of apprentice level duties involved in the operation, maintenance, and repair of Stormwater collection systems, equipment, and facilities.

 

SUPERVISION EXERCISED

 

None.

 

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

 

·      Assigned to work in one of the three utility divisions and will work generally within that division to test, maintain, inspect, repair, and clean the various utility pipes, fittings, inlets, basins, valves, or other apparatus associated with the utility.

·      May involve emergency call-out or overtime repair work, working in various weather conditions, at various times of the day/night.

·      Perform general maintenance and cleanup duties around facilities.

·      Operate a variety of vehicles, tools, and equipment used in the operation and maintenance of utility distribution and collection systems.

·      Operate TV inspection truck and related equipment to inspect storm drain lines.

·      Troubleshoot problems with the TV system including camera, tractor, drum, computer, and software.

·      Assist and or operate jet truck to clean stormwater main lines; excavate, repair, and replace stormwater mains.

·      Maintain stormwater equipment in operating order by inspecting, removing, repairing, and replacing malfunctioning parts and sections.

·      Inspect and clean the interiors of stormwater control devices

·      Conduct routine tests of stormwater pipes.

·      Cut and remove roots, debris, and other obstacles from stormwater pipes.

·      Remove and inspect manhole covers and manholes; mix, pour, and finish concrete to raise manholes to street surfaces; replace manhole covers as needed.

·      Excavate and repair of stormwater lines, connections, manholes, debris basins, and stormwater basins and their appurtenances.

·      Clean storm drains; remove water from flooded streets.

·      Perform other related duties and responsibilities as assigned.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

 

Education: High school diploma or GED.

 

Certifications/Licenses:

·      Valid Utah Driver’s License

·      Possession of, or ability to obtain a Utah commercial driver's license within 1 year of employment in the position.

·      Possession of, or ability to obtain Traffic Control Flagger, Trench Shoring, and Confined Space certificates within 6 months of employment (training typically provided by City). Director may grant extension if training isn’t available during 6-month period.

 

STORMWATER SYSTEM OPERATOR I

Experience: One year of experience performing construction related activities.

 

Certifications/Licenses:

·      Possession of, or ability to obtain Grade I Wastewater Collection System certificate within 1 year of employment.

 

STORMWATER SYSTEM OPERATOR II

Experience: Two years of experience in Stormwater collection system operations.

 

Certifications/Licenses:

·      Possession of an unrestricted Grade I (or higher) Wastewater Collection Certificate
